网站个人主页海口网站模板系统
网站个人主页,海口网站模板系统,网站建设费走什么科目,ps抠图教程Tftpd64轻量级部署指南#xff1a;从个人到企业的全场景配置实践 【免费下载链接】tftpd64 The working repository of the famous TFTP server. 项目地址: https://gitcode.com/gh_mirrors/tf/tftpd64
一、需求定位#xff1a;如何判断Tftpd64是否适合你的网络环境&a…Tftpd64轻量级部署指南从个人到企业的全场景配置实践【免费下载链接】tftpd64The working repository of the famous TFTP server.项目地址: https://gitcode.com/gh_mirrors/tf/tftpd64一、需求定位如何判断Tftpd64是否适合你的网络环境在选择文件传输解决方案时为何Tftpd64能成为众多网络管理员的首选工具作为一款集成TFTP服务器、DHCP服务、DNS中继和SYSLOG服务的开源网络工具Tftpd64特别适合资源受限环境和轻量级部署需求。本文将通过五段式框架帮助不同规模用户构建高效稳定的网络服务体系。1.1 环境适配性评估如何确定Tftpd64是否符合你的系统环境以下是关键评估维度评估项目最低配置推荐配置企业级配置操作系统Windows XP/Server 2003Windows 10/Server 2016Windows Server 2019/2022内存256MB1GB4GB存储100MB空闲空间1GB SSD10GB 高性能存储网络100Mbps网卡千兆网卡多网卡冗余配置1.2 用户规模与功能选择决策不同规模用户应如何选择Tftpd64的功能组合个人用户仅启用TFTP服务器功能满足嵌入式开发调试需求小型团队TFTPDHCP组合实现设备自动配置企业环境全功能启用配合安全策略实现完整网络服务二、功能解析Tftpd64核心组件如何协同工作Tftpd64的模块化设计使其能够灵活适应不同场景需求。各服务组件既可以独立运行也能协同工作形成完整解决方案。2.1 TFTP服务器核心能力TFTP服务作为Tftpd64的核心功能如何实现高效文件传输其关键特性包括支持GET/PUT双向文件传输多客户端并发处理机制实时传输进度监控与统计灵活的安全权限控制Tftpd64多客户端传输监控界面显示多台设备同时传输文件的进度、速率和状态信息2.2 辅助服务功能解析除核心TFTP服务外Tftpd64还提供哪些网络服务组件DHCP服务自动分配IP地址支持PXE网络引导DNS中继实现简单域名解析减轻主DNS服务器负载SYSLOG服务集中收集网络设备日志便于故障诊断技术点睛各服务组件可独立启用建议仅开启实际需要的服务以减少资源占用和安全风险。三、实战部署分阶段实施指南如何根据用户规模选择合适的部署方案以下分阶段实施方法可帮助你快速构建稳定的Tftpd64服务。3.1 个人开发者环境部署【1/3】个人用户如何在5分钟内完成基础TFTP服务配置⚠️ 风险提示部署前请确保防火墙允许UDP 69端口通信从官方仓库获取源码并编译git clone https://gitcode.com/gh_mirrors/tf/tftpd64 cd tftpd64/src # 根据编译指南完成构建基础配置步骤启动程序后在Current Directory选择文件存储路径在Server interfaces下拉菜单中选择本机IP地址点击Settings按钮在TFTP标签页确认端口设置为69勾选TFTP Server选项启用服务功能验证使用tftp命令测试文件传输tftp -i [服务器IP] get test.txt观察传输进度条和日志信息确认服务正常运行3.2 小型团队环境部署【2/3】团队环境如何配置TFTPDHCP组合服务Tftpd64的DHCP配置界面显示IP地址池设置、租约时间和引导文件配置选项DHCP服务配置在设置界面切换到DHCP标签页配置IP池起始地址和池大小设置租约时间建议小型网络设为2880分钟指定Boot File名称如pxelinux.0网络参数配置填写网关、子网掩码和DNS服务器信息勾选Ping address before assignation避免IP冲突配置Additional Option以支持特殊设备需求3.3 企业级部署方案【3/3】企业环境如何实现安全稳定的Tftpd64部署⚠️ 安全警告企业部署必须启用访问控制和日志审计功能防止未授权访问服务器环境准备配置专用服务器安装稳定版操作系统设置静态IP地址和域名解析配置RAID存储确保数据可靠性安全加固措施在TFTP Security中选择Read Only模式配置虚拟根目录限制文件访问范围绑定服务到特定网络接口设置强密码保护管理界面监控与维护策略启用日志记录所有传输活动配置定期日志备份和审计设置服务自动启动和故障恢复机制四、性能调优从基础到高级的配置策略如何根据网络环境调整Tftpd64参数以获得最佳性能以下优化策略适用于不同级别的部署需求。4.1 TFTP传输参数优化决策Tftpd64高级设置界面红色框内为性能优化相关选项关键参数配置决策指南参数家庭网络优化企业局域网优化广域网优化超时时间3秒5秒10秒重试次数6次4次8次块大小512字节1024字节2048字节端口范围默认10000-10100自定义范围4.2 服务性能优化实践技术点睛性能优化应遵循测量-调整-验证的循环过程避免盲目修改参数网络优化绑定服务到特定网卡避免多网卡冲突调整MTU值适应网络环境一般设置为1500对于高延迟网络启用Option negotiation系统优化将TFTP根目录放在SSD存储上关闭不必要的系统服务释放资源配置Hide Window at startup减少资源占用高级优化选项启用Use anticipation window提升传输效率配置Local port pool避免端口冲突对于大文件传输启用Create md5 files验证完整性五、问题排查系统化故障解决方法当Tftpd64服务出现异常时如何快速定位并解决问题以下系统化排查方法可帮助你高效诊断各类故障。5.1 连接故障排查流程TFTP客户端无法连接服务器时应按以下步骤排查基础连通性检查确认服务器IP地址和端口是否正确配置使用ping命令测试网络连通性检查防火墙设置确保UDP 69端口开放服务状态验证确认Tftpd64服务是否正常运行检查服务器日志文件获取错误信息验证服务是否绑定到正确的网络接口5.2 文件传输问题解决方案问题现象可能原因解决方法传输速度缓慢块大小设置不当增大块大小至1024或2048字节传输频繁中断超时设置过短增加超时时间至5-10秒权限拒绝错误目录权限不足调整TFTP根目录权限或更改安全模式客户端无法找到文件路径配置错误检查基础目录设置或启用Allow as virtual root5.3 服务启动故障处理当Tftpd64无法启动服务时应检查⚠️ 紧急排查项目使用命令netstat -ano | findstr :69检查端口占用情况确认配置文件tftpd32.ini是否损坏可删除后重新配置尝试以管理员身份运行程序检查系统事件日志获取详细错误信息六、服务监控与告警配置如何确保Tftpd64服务持续稳定运行建立完善的监控机制是关键。6.1 日志监控配置启用详细日志记录在Settings的Global标签页勾选Log to file设置日志文件路径和滚动策略配置日志级别为Verbose以获取详细信息日志分析要点关注Error和Warning级别的日志条目定期检查客户端IP分布识别异常访问统计文件传输频率优化存储策略6.2 服务健康检查定期测试流程创建定时任务执行TFTP传输测试监控服务进程状态和资源占用检查磁盘空间和文件系统健康状态告警机制配置配置日志关键字告警如ERROR、Failed设置磁盘空间阈值告警配置服务未运行自动重启脚本通过本文指南你已掌握Tftpd64从环境评估到高级优化的全流程部署知识。无论是个人开发测试还是企业级应用合理配置和持续监控是确保服务稳定运行的关键。根据实际需求选择合适的功能组合和优化策略将使Tftpd64成为你网络基础设施中的可靠组件。【免费下载链接】tftpd64The working repository of the famous TFTP server.项目地址: https://gitcode.com/gh_mirrors/tf/tftpd64创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考